To use up the available LTIR space, Edmonton needs to be as close to the cap when Klefbom is put on LTIR.
I could see something like the following:
- Sign Yamamoto, 1yr, $2.120m
- Demote Turris, Russell, McLeod, Lagesson, Benson (I have Benson lost to waivers, which wouldn't be a shock.)
- Submit roster with Klefbom
- Put Klefbom on LTIR ($199 from cap.)
- Recall Turris, Russell, McLeod, Lagesson
